Business Plan

A business plan provides goals, marketing strategies, and financial projections that help guide window installation and repair businesses from their initial planning stages to when revenue starts being generated. Structure, tax and insurance considerations must also be factored into any good plan.

Determine your target market and understand what makes your window fitting business special to customers. Whether your focus will be on residential windows or renovation projects for businesses, understanding your niche helps establish the direction of your business and target the right clients.

Estimate start-up costs, such as tools, licensing, office space and vehicles. By keeping an accurate tab on both startup and ongoing expenses, it will allow you to make informed decisions and secure supplier discounts.

Window installation and repair businesses often need multiple types of insurance policies depending on their size. One key aspect is general liability coverage which protects against third-party bodily injury claims during projects as well as property damage claims made against their business by customers or clients.
